Enjoy a guided tour through the British Museum. Uncover the museum's most spectacular treasures. Stand before the Rosetta Stone, marvel at the Tang dynasty tomb figures, and witness the grandeur of the Parthenon Sculptures.
Begin your adventure in the magnificent Enlightenment Gallery, the museum's oldest room, which used to be the King’s library. Stand before the legendary Rosetta Stone, the key that unlocked the mysteries of ancient Egyptian hieroglyphs and changed our understanding of history forever.
Witness the grandeur of ancient Greece through the iconic Parthenon Sculptures, feeling the power and movement captured in marble by master sculptors 2,500 years ago.
Come face-to-face with Hoa Hakananai'a, the enigmatic Easter Island statue whose presence commands silence and wonder. Experience the charm and intrigue of the Lewis Chessmen, whose expressive faces tell tales of medieval European life, before concluding with the awe-inspiring treasures of Sutton Hoo.
